The second step is to select what files you want burned. First you need to specify what type of disk to burn (audio, MP3 or data). The options are placed in a logical order on the left side of the interface. To burn your media or other data to a CD or DVD, you must go through three easy steps, in the Burn section. The files themselves, regardless of type and format, are displayed as thumbnails and if you hover with your mouse cursor over them, you will find options for playing, moving, copying or sharing the media. For example, in the Music category, the files are organized in different folders, according to genre, artist or album. Everything is placed in categories and sub-categories. Besides videos or music, you can also use the media library to organize your pictures, downloads and recordings and more.
